第5章-数据库系统.docx
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
6 第5章 数据库系统 1:数据库管理系统(DBMS)是一种_____B_____软件。 A 应用 B 系统 C 编程 D 编辑 2:下列语言中,_____A______是关系数据库的标准语言。 A SQL语言 B C语言 C Foxpro 语言 D C++语言 3:关系数据库中元组的集合称为关系。通常唯一标识元组的属性是___C______。 A 标记 B 字段 C 主键 D 记录 4:下列说法____B______是不正确的 A 数据库减少了数据冗余 B 数据库避免了一切数据重复 C 数据库中的数据可以共享 D 数据库中的数据安全可以控制 5:在数据管理技术的发展过程中,可实现数据高度共享的阶段是___C_____。 A 人工管理阶段 B 文件系统阶段 C 数据库系统阶段 D 系统管理阶段 6:在一个关系中,不能有完全相同的___A______。 A 元组 B 标记 C 分量 D 域 7: E-R图是表示概念模型的有效工具之一,E-R图中使用菱形框表示 ___A______。 A 联系 B 实体 C 实体的属性 D 联系的属性 8:下列不属于数据模型的是___A______ 。 A E-R模型 B 层次模型 C 网状模型 D 关系模型 9: 关系数据模型_____D_______。 A 只能表示实体间的1:1联系 B 只能表示实体间的1:N联系 C 只能表示实体间的M:N联系 D 可以表示实体间的上述3种联系 10:已知某个公司有多个部门,每个部门又有多名职工,而每一个职工只能属于一个部门,则部门与职工之间的关系是____B_____。 A 一对一 B 一对多 C 多对多 D 多对一 11:在用户看来,关系模型中数据的逻辑结构是一张___A_____。 A 二维表 B 图形 C 表格 D 图片 12:在关系模型R(身份证号码,姓名,性别,出生日期)中,最适合作为主键的是__A_____。 A 身份证号码 B 姓名 C 出生日期 D 身份证号码+姓名 13:关系代数运算的对象是 __A____。 A 关系 B 值 C 域 D 列 14:若1={1, 2, 3}, 2={1, 2, 3},则1×2集合中共有元组___C___个。 A 6 B 8 C 9 D 12 15:数据库管理系统提供的数据______D_______语言,可以对数据库的数据实现更新。 A 查询 B 定义 C 控制 D 操纵 16: _____B______是位于用户和操作系统之间的一层数据管理软件。数据库在建立、使用和维护时由其统一管理、统一控制。 A DB B DBMS C DBS D DBA 17: 取出关系中的某些列,并消去重复的元组的关系运算称为___B____。 A 取列运算 B 投影运算 C 连接运算 D 选择运算 18.数据库管理系统通常提供授权功能来控制不同用户访问数据的权限,主要是为了实现数据库的_____D_____。 A 可靠性 B 一致性 C 完整性 D 安全性 19.在关系数据模型中,通常可以把_____D_______称为属性。 A 记录 B 基本表 C 模式 D 字段 20.数据库设计的起点是____B_____。 A、系统设计阶段 B、需求分析阶段 C、概念结构设计阶段 D、逻辑结构设计阶段 21.在数据库设计中,设计E-R图是____B_______任务。 A 需求分析阶段 B 概念设计阶段 C 逻辑设计阶段 D 物理设计阶段 22.假如采用关系数据库系统来实现应用,在数据库设计的___D_____阶段,需要将E-R模型转换为关系数据模型。 A.概念设计 B.物理设计 C. 运行阶段 D. 逻辑设计 23.数据库设计可分为6个阶段,每个阶段都有自己的设计内容,"为哪些关系,在哪些属性上、建什么样的索引"这一设计内容应该属于____B____设计阶段。 A、概念设计 B、逻辑设计 C、物理设计 D、全局设计 24.SQL语言允许使用通配符进行字符串匹配的操作,其中'%'可以表示____D_____。 A、零个字符 B、1个字符 C、多个字符 D、以上都可以 25.在SELECT语句的WHERE子句的条件表达式中,可以匹配0个到多个字符的通配符是(B ) A * B % C - D ? 26.SQL Server 2000是一个____C____的数据库系统。 A 网状型 B 层次型 C 关系型 D以上都不是 27.下列不属于数据库系统组成的是____B____。 A. DB B. ASP C. DBA D. 计算机硬件 28.数据库系统不仅包括数据库本身,还要包括相应的硬件、软件和____D____。 A. 最终用户 B. DBA C. 数据库应用系统开发人员 D. 各类相关人员 29.在数据库中存储的是____C____。 【数据库系统概述】 数据库系统(Database System,简称DBS)是用于存储、管理和检索数据的软件系统,它结合了数据库管理系统(DBMS)、数据库、硬件、操作系统和用户等多个元素。DBMS是数据库系统的核心,是一种系统软件,负责管理和控制数据库的创建、查询、更新和维护。SQL(Structured Query Language)是关系数据库的标准语言,用于操作和管理数据库。 【关系数据库基本概念】 关系数据库是基于关系数据模型的,其中元组(或记录)的集合称为关系。每个元组由多个字段(或属性)组成,而主键是用来唯一标识元组的字段组合。数据冗余在数据库中是被尽量避免的,以提高数据的一致性和减少更新异常。数据库中的数据可以被多个用户共享,并且可以通过权限控制确保数据安全性。 【数据管理技术的发展】 数据管理技术经历了人工管理、文件系统和数据库系统三个阶段。数据库系统阶段实现了数据的高度共享,通过数据库管理系统进行统一管理和控制。 【关系数据模型】 关系数据模型不仅可以表示实体间的一对一(1:1)、一对多(1:N)和多对多(M:N)联系。例如,部门与职工的关系通常是一对多关系,一个部门可以有多名职工,但每个职工只能属于一个部门。 【数据模型】 数据模型包括层次模型、网状模型和关系模型,其中E-R模型是用于描述概念数据模型的工具,它使用实体、属性和联系来表达数据结构。关系模型是最常用的数据模型,其逻辑结构表现为二维表。 【数据库操作】 关系代数是描述对关系进行操作的集合运算,对象是关系。投影运算用于选取关系中的部分列并去除重复元组;选择运算用于根据指定条件选取满足条件的行;连接运算则用于合并两个或更多关系的行。 【数据库管理系统功能】 DBMS提供数据操纵语言(DML),如SQL,用于数据的增、删、改、查。此外,DBMS还包含数据定义语言(DDL)用于创建和修改数据库结构,以及数据控制语言(DCL)用于权限管理,确保数据安全性。 【数据库设计】 数据库设计包括需求分析、概念设计、逻辑设计、物理设计等阶段。E-R图是概念设计阶段的重要工具,用于描述实体、属性和实体间的关系。在逻辑设计阶段,E-R模型会被转换为关系数据模型,以便在实际的数据库系统中实现。 【数据库系统的组成】 完整的数据库系统包括数据库(DB)、数据库管理系统(DBMS)、数据库管理员(DBA)、硬件、软件及各类相关人员。数据库中存储的是按照一定结构组织的数据,而非原始的位或文件。 数据库系统是现代信息系统的核心,它通过精心设计和管理,确保数据的高效、安全和一致。了解这些基本概念和操作对于理解和应用数据库技术至关重要。
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/release/download_crawler_static/87794431/bg1.jpg)
![avatar-default](https://csdnimg.cn/release/downloadcmsfe/public/img/lazyLogo2.1882d7f4.png)
![avatar](https://profile-avatar.csdnimg.cn/f3d219d0e10d40ef9bf4553a2dcb10a5_qq_43966957.jpg!1)
- 粉丝: 100
- 资源: 9355
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助
![voice](https://csdnimg.cn/release/downloadcmsfe/public/img/voice.245cc511.png)
![center-task](https://csdnimg.cn/release/downloadcmsfe/public/img/center-task.c2eda91a.png)
最新资源
- SQL中的CREATE LOGFILE GROUP 语句.pdf
- C语言-leetcode题解之第172题阶乘后的零.zip
- C语言-leetcode题解之第171题Excel列表序号.zip
- C语言-leetcode题解之第169题多数元素.zip
- ocr-图像识别资源ocr-图像识别资源
- 图像识别:基于Resnet50 + VGG16模型融合的人体细胞癌症分类模型实现-图像识别资源
- C语言-leetcode题解之第168题Excel列表名称.zip
- C语言-leetcode题解之第167题两数之和II-输入有序数组.zip
- C语言-leetcode题解之第166题分数到小数.zip
- C语言-leetcode题解之第165题比较版本号.zip
![feedback](https://img-home.csdnimg.cn/images/20220527035711.png)
![feedback-tip](https://img-home.csdnimg.cn/images/20220527035111.png)
![dialog-icon](https://csdnimg.cn/release/downloadcmsfe/public/img/green-success.6a4acb44.png)